Transaction 2990340fc66ba4e62cb65d3b021a5ed114ea6f07d41098c00b8728f376092774
1 Input
1 Output
-
2990340fc66ba4e62cb65d3b021a5ed114ea6f07d41098c00b8728f376092774:0
- value
- 1250
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 dd7e524c6b018633c0d5dc2bd4b5e325c2f87b0de52486c01872ddf24a1c07b9
- address
- bc1pm4l9ynrtqxrr8sx4ms4afd0ryhp0s7cdu5jgdsqcwtwlyjsuq7uszvl8pw